Its easy to become complacent around so much
noise/experimental/drone/ambient music right now - week in
week out you can lose yourself in a quagmire of limited cdr
releases, cassette tapes and lathe cut wax, so much so that it
can be difficult nay impossible to cherry-pick the real gems.
Well Axolotl, at least to my mind, has been one of the genres
most consistently interesting artists the side project of
long-time noisy feller Karl Bauer (Black Dice, Double
Leopards, Mouthus etc) he has managed somehow to keep a steady
stream of both releases and quality, dipping into more than
enough sick collaborations whenever he can. Sitting awkwardly
between the pastoral, noisy bliss of Fennesz, the blurry
drug-haze of The Skaters, the measured psychedelic magic of
Grouper and the pure synthesized power of Tim Hecker the music
of Axolotl can be difficult to place, but there are enough
reference points to get stuck in quickly and easily. Far from
the difficult and tiresome listening experience you might be
expecting, this collection has been picked expertly compiling
Bauers most intriguing and most difficult to obtain works and
putting them together in one easy package, a disc which plays
beautifully from beginning to end. Memory Theatre opens with
the fabulous Chemical Theater, which could be mistaken for
Christian Fennesz filtering the noisy electronics of the
Yellow Swans. A devastatingly powerful yet surprisingly
sensitive track, this is instantly what sets Bauer apart from
so many of his contemporaries. In a scene where quality
control is regarded as far less important than amount of
releases, its refreshing to hear a collection of work which
sounds so expertly realised without losing that punky bedroom
psych sound we know and love. Elsewhere Natura Naturans
sounds something like the Eraserhead soundtrack playing at
half speed while an ice cream van sidles by, Illiaster shows
Bauers truly sensitive side with bells and whistles
(really...) and the disc is closed with the mind-melting
Forclusion, an eleven minute organ work which threatens to
beat Tim Hecker at his own game. An essential purchase for
anyone with an interest in top quality psychedelic ambience -
Axolotl is an artist you simply need to get a great deal more
knowledgeable about...
